}New file upload utility
A new FileUploadUtil.gs file has been added:
package edge.security.fileupload
uses java.io.ByteArrayInputStream
uses javax.imageio.ImageIO
uses java.io.IOException
uses javax.imageio.IIOException
uses java.nio.charset.StandardCharsets
uses java.net.URLEncoder
uses java.util.regex.Pattern
uses edge.security.fileupload.exception.IllegalContentTypeException
uses gw.api.util.Logger
uses org.apache.commons.fileupload2.core.FileItem
uses java.io.ByteArrayOutputStream
uses org.apache.tika.Tika
public class FileUploadUtil {
private static final var MAX_UPLOAD_BYTES = 25 * 1024 * 1024 // 25 MB
private static final var LOG = Logger.forCategory(FileUploadUtil.Type.QName)
private static final var TIKA = new Tika()
// Unicode control / bidi / zero-width / non-character ranges that break
// Content-Disposition serialization and enable RTL-override filename spoofing.
// Disallowed at upload; stripped at download for any pre-existing stored names.
// U+061C Arabic Letter Mark (ALM, bidi formatter)
// U+200B-200F zero-width and bidi marks (ZWSP, ZWNJ, ZWJ, LRM, RLM)
// U+202A-202E bidi embedding/override (incl. RLO U+202E)
// U+2066-2069 bidi isolates (LRI, RLI, FSI, PDI -- Trojan Source vectors)
// U+2028-2029 line/paragraph separators
// U+FEFF BOM / zero-width no-break space
// U+FFFD replacement character
// Plus all C0 (0x00-0x1F) and C1 (0x7F-0x9F) control chars.
private static final var DISALLOWED_NAME_CHAR : String =
"[\\u0000-\\u001F\\u007F-\\u009F\\u061C\\u200B-\\u200F\\u202A-\\u202E\\u2066-\\u2069\\u2028\\u2029\\uFEFF\\uFFFD]"

New Jutro Cloud Standards package
The Jutro 10.13.0 release introduces a new Jutro Cloud Standards package. This package provides Stylelint and ESLint configurations that validate your application against Cloud Standards. Cloud Standards help ensure that your application uses only public Jutro APIs and does not violate framework guidelines. You might see additional warnings when you run applications locally or in TeamCity, but the warnings won't block your builds.
For more information, see Cloud Standards - Use of Jutro APIs.
Updated Lerna version
Digital reference applications now use Lerna 8.2.3. This release also updates the Lerna configuration format. This change is optional, however, it's recommended that you make the updates in this release.
- Create a new property in your package.json file called
"workspaces": []. - Move the list of packages in your lerna.json file to
workspacesin your package.json file. - In your
lerna.jsonfile, add the following properties:"$schema": "node_modules/lerna/schemas/lerna-schema.json","npmClient": "npm","useWorkspaces": true
- Remove any deprecated Lerna commands and options from your scripts and package.json file.
